The present petition has been filed by the petitioner with the following prayers:- "That this Hon'ble Court may be pleased to:- a.

Issue a writ of mandamus or any other writ or direction directing restoration of electricity in the Petitioner's premise bearing No. I-56, left portion of ground floor, Lajpat Nagar-II, New Delhi, during pendency of the appeal currently pending before the Ld. ADM (South East); and b.

Pass such other order(s) as this Hon'ble Court may deem fit and proper in the interest of justice."

2.

The learned counsel for the respondents states, even though there is an inter se dispute between the petitioner and his landlord, the electricity has

been disconnected by the respondents because of non-payment of Rs.18,000/- as consumption charges. He concedes the issue whether the petitioner is liable to pay domestic charges or commercial charges is pending consideration with the concerned ADM. He also states, the respondents shall accept the payment of Rs.18,000/- if tendered by the petitioner and on such payment, the electricity shall be restored within 2 days, thereafter.

3.

Learned counsel for the petitioner is agreeable to this submission of the learned counsel for the respondents. He also states that the petitioner shall continue to pay the future consumption charges on domestic rates. 4.

Noting the submission made above, the petitioner shall deposit the arrears of the consumption charges amounting to Rs.18,000/- on or before July 17, 2018. Upon receipt of the payment, the respondents shall restore the electricity connection within two days thereafter. The petition is disposed of.

CM No. 26117/2018 Dismissed as infructuous.
